The band consists of the following members: Howard Birchmore

Howard Birchmore - Bass Guitar and Harmonica.

  • Howard joined the band in the mid 80s. Until Dave joined we still thought of him as the new boy. Howard was inspired to take up harmonica on hearing Sony Boy Williamson's single 'Help Me'. This lead to the guitar and on into the folk scene. Howard played a leading role in the Folk/rock bands Motley, Trouble T'Mill and Summit in the Windsor and West London area in the 1970s. The big time always managed to avoid them so he was reduced to following an almost normal 9-5 existence where he is developing a career as an artist.
Paul Critchfield

Paul Critchfield - Drums and percussion or Bass Guitar

  • Paul plays bass for various blues bands and was introduced to us by Fran Wood. He has played for us since start of 2003 and is now settling down as a regular player. Paul also plays Bass so when Howard is unavailable he can substitute.

 

 
Dave Fenner

Dave Fenner - Electric Guitar, Accoustic Guitar, Mandola

  • Dave having sat in on a few gigs when we were caught short, joined the band in June 1994. He has a musical pedigree which includes a variety of bands, duos, solo work etc. including a period as a duo with Andy Lavery in the late 80s and with his wife Alison. Dave used to dance with Crendon Morris until he damaged a knee dancing on uneven pavement slabs.

 
Richard Holland

Richard Holland - Keyboards

  • Richard Holland provided all the keyboard parts for our current CD. He is primarily known for being a mean Banjo player, member of the duo Footloose and organiser of the American Music concerts at Nettlebed.

 

 
Rex Morrey

Rex Morrey - Whistles, Recorder and Alto Sax

  • Rex is one of the founder members. Rex digs out most of our material although the arrangements are strictly a team effort. He also engineers and mixes all our studio recordings. Rex's musical pedigree includes a period playing whistle and recorder with Kennet Morris, sound engineer for Scotch Measure and he engineered and mixed all the Geckoes albums.
